Before diving into complex repairs, it is essential to distinguish between physical damage and logical errors. If your computer doesn’t detect the drive at all, or if the USB connector is bent, you are likely dealing with a hardware issue. However, if the drive appears in your system but shows errors like “Access Denied” or “Please Insert Disk,” a logical usb flash memory repair is usually possible through software.
USB 2.0 vs 3.0: Performance and Repair Implications
When troubleshooting, it is helpful to know the hardware standard you are working with. The comparison of usb 2.0 vs 3.0 isn’t just about speed; it also affects how the device interacts with your motherboard’s power delivery.
USB 2.0: Recognizable by its black internal plastic, it offers speeds up to 480 Mbps. These older drives are often more susceptible to “under-powering” issues on modern front-panel ports.
USB 3.0 (and 3.1/3.2): Distinguished by blue internal plastic (usually), these offer speeds up to 5 Gbps and higher. They require more sophisticated controllers, which means firmware-level usb flash memory repair can be more complex than with older 2.0 models.
If a USB 3.0 drive is failing, try plugging it into a USB 2.0 port. Sometimes, the slower data rate allows a failing controller to stabilize long enough for you to move your files.
Initial Troubleshooting and Software Fixes
Many “broken” drives are simply suffering from file system confusion. Before reaching for heavy-duty tools, let’s try the built-in Windows repair features.
Step 1: Check for Driver Issues
Sometimes the drive is fine, but the “bridge” between the OS and the hardware is broken.
Right-click the Start button and select Device Manager.
Expand Universal Serial Bus controllers.
Right-click your USB Mass Storage Device and select Uninstall device.
Unplug the USB, restart your computer, and plug it back in. Windows will automatically reinstall the driver.
Step 2: Use the CHKDSK Command
The “Check Disk” tool is a powerful ally in usb flash memory repair. It scans the file system and repairs logical bad sectors.
Type cmd in the Windows search bar, right-click, and Run as Administrator.
Type chkdsk E: /f (Replace E: with your actual USB drive letter).

When the file system is marked as “RAW” or the drive is write-protected, a standard Windows format often fails. In these cases, a dedicated usb flash disk formatter tool is required to reset the drive’s low-level structure.
When to Use a USB Flash Disk Formatter
If you receive the error “Windows was unable to complete the format,” the partition table is likely destroyed. Professional formatting tools like the HP USB Disk Storage Format Tool or the HDD LLF Low Level Format Tool can force a rewrite of the boot sector.
Step 1: Download a reputable usb flash disk formatter tool.
Step 2: Run the application as an Administrator.
Step 3: Select the “Low-Level Format” option if the drive is severely corrupted.
Step 4: Choose the FAT32 or exFAT file system.
Step 5: Click “Format this device.” This will wipe all data but often restores a “dead” drive to a functional state.
Master Guide: How to Format a USB Drive Correctly
Once your usb flash memory repair is complete, or if you simply want to start fresh, you must know how to format a usb drive properly for your specific needs. Formatting isn’t just about deleting files; it’s about choosing the right architecture.
How to Format a USB Drive: Complete Beginner-Friendly Guide
On Windows:
Insert the USB drive: Plug it into an available port.
Open File Explorer: Use the shortcut Win + E.
Right-click the drive: Find your USB under “This PC” and select Format.
Choose File System: Select exFAT for best compatibility between Mac and PC.
Quick Format: Ensure “Quick Format” is checked unless you suspect the drive has physical errors.
Start: Click Start and then OK to confirm.
On macOS:
Open Disk Utility (via Spotlight or Applications > Utilities).
Select the USB drive from the left sidebar.
Click the Erase button at the top.
Select a Name and choose exFAT or MS-DOS (FAT) for the format.
Click Erase to finish the process.
Resolving Write Protection and “ReadOnly” Errors
A common hurdle in usb flash memory repair is the dreaded write protection. If you can’t add or delete files, try the Registry fix:
Press Win + R, type regedit, and hit Enter.
Navigate to: H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Control\StorageDevicePolicies
If StorageDevicePolicies doesn’t exist, you may need to create it.
Find the WriteProtect DWORD value and change it from 1 to 0.
Restart your computer.

Successful usb flash memory repair is a rewarding process, but prevention is always better than cure. To keep your flash drive healthy:
Always use the “Safely Remove Hardware” option.
Avoid using your USB drive as a primary workspace; work on your PC and copy the final version to the USB.
Keep your drive away from extreme heat and moisture.
